Mission Profile
Strela-1M 257-264 was a Kosmos-3M mission operated by Soviet Space Program that lifted off from 132/1 (132L), Plesetsk Cosmodrome, Russian Federation on January 19, 1983. The flight carried its payload on a government/top secret mission to Low Earth Orbit. The launch was a success.
